M0RSF/P 20M SOTA activation of G/NP-017 Fountains Fell

Published December 8, 2015December 6, 2015 by editor


Short video of a SOTA activation on 20M running 2W from my Yaesu FT817ND into an EFHW antenna. Not ideal as there was a contest on and plenty of QRM.

LU8EEM calling CQ 15m 14.09.2015 while I was on SOTA

Published December 6, 2015December 6, 2015 by editor


I worked Ruben Jose (LU8EEM) from Lincoln, Buenos Aires (Argentinia) during my SOTA activation at Wildenburger Kopf, Germany (DM/RP-187) – 14.09.2015.
